The airport is different than others.You have to go trough baggage claim twice!!!. After you arrive you go trough passport control.The officer takes your passport and the packet from the embassy put it in a plastic folder and ask for another officer to come and escort you to a office where they will review your documents. Don't expect them to be fast. They are not in any hurry. After waiting probably 40min in this office then proceeded to get my suitcases. You need to drop them again at a lane and get trough a security check for your hand luggage. Then you show your customs form to a guy. I bought some things from duty free and they pulled me out for additional luggage checks (this was while i was with my suitcases). After that you go on a train to baggage claim and hope your luggage is there. Mine wasn't. I asked the lady from the airline and she said it might take 1-1.5 hours to get it!!!! Mine was out in 30 min (thank god). The whole experience took 3 hours after landing. Be prepared for some waiting. GOOD LUCK |

The Atlanta airport is large and kind of a mess to navigate. However, everything with immigration went smoothly. My fiance arrived on a Tuesday afternoon, which could be why there was not much of a wait for him. They checked my fiance's passport, visa, took his fingerprints and then put his passport and sealed envelope in a clear plastic envelope with green trim on it, and took him to another room. He waited about 10 minutes before he was called, where the immigration officer opened his package to enter him in the system. He was nice and personable, and only asked a few basic questions like my name, address, when and where we were getting married. He was helpful and kind enough to take the time to write out his A# for him when he was told we did not get the A# on our NOA2. He reminded him that he only had 90 days to get married, filled out and stamped his I-94, and then congratulated him and sent him on his way. The overall time it took from waiting in lines, getting fingerprinted, and talking to the immigration officer was 20-30 minutes. |

Got off the plane, went to the immigration and joined the queue, waited for about 45 mins., staffs were friendly, when it comes to my turn, they opened the K1 package, asked me few basic questions; when is the wedding, where in the states i'm going to stay, what's my fiance surname. While the staff asking me questions, at the same time, took my fingerprints and a photo shot, then directed me to the isolated room for more immigration check. There was a bunch of people waited ahead of me, so it took me to 1 & 1/2 hr to wait for my turn. After the long wait, stamped my passport, got the I-94 form w/ A# on it & reminded me to marry w/in 90 dys.
